BENJAMIN V. MEZA

Senior Project Architect


As a project architect Ben has worked on medical, military, administrative, training, and industrial projects. Ben is also responsible for the day to day management of the firm's computer systems. Other responsibilities at Architects/Larson/ Carpenter include:

  • project design
  • construction documents
  • CAFM systems
  • CADD management

Professional Leadership
Ben's professional commitment is exemplified by design quality, communication and attention to detail.

Education
Ben is a 1985 graduate of California State Polytechnic University, Pomona. He is a California State licensed architect.  Ben is also a U.S. Green Building Council LEED Accredited Professional.

Personal Interests
Oil Painting, Photography, and Digital Art.

Community Activities
Ben is a member of the City of Chula Vista Rotary Club.  He is also a Volunteer design architect of Project La Escuela, an elementary school in a low income Tijuana, Mexico neighborhood.
